Mozilla has released critical updates for Firefox, Thunderbird and its SeaMonkey application suite. Left unpatched, the vulnerabilities could allow hackers to execute cross-site scripting attacks on a user's PC. The affected versions of Firefox are all versions of Firefox 1.0 below 1.5.0.9 and all versions of Firefox 2 below 2.0.0.1. For more details, see this article on CNET or this bulletin from Secuina.
